The Effects of Muscle Mass on Mortality

The literature supports the idea that what's really bad is low levels of muscle mass. The cut offs kind of differ from study to study, but I usually think about it in terms of FMI or the fat free mass index. For women, the risk really starts to increase for things like all cause mortality at FMI below 14. And for men, it's about 17. Of course, there's like a buffer there, you don't want to be right on the cut-off.
